Coming in at corner are Shawn Springs and Leigh Bodden, both of whom were available because they were slightly disappointing in their last stops. The Patriots need them to work out in that magical "Bill Belichick squeezes every last drop of production out of veteran free agents" kind of a way. The secondary's leader, Rodney Harrison, has retired to take a position in the NBC booth where he will advocate for new NFL rules that dictate that a ball carrier isn't down until his windpipe has been crushed, and the Patriots are counting on rookie Patrick Chung to take his place.
